// query parameters

struct queryparamclass {
  text_t combinequery;
  text_t collection;

  // search_index = index+subcollection+language
  text_t index;
  text_t subcollection;
  text_t language;
  text_t level; // for new mg stuff
  text_t querystring;
  int search_type; // 0 = boolean, 1 = ranked
  int match_mode; // 0 = some, 1 = all
  int casefolding;
  int stemming;
  int accentfolding;
  int maxdocs;
  int maxnumeric;
  text_t filterstring; // Filter specified (currently only used by Lucene)
  text_t sortfield; // Field to use for sorting result set (currently used by lucene)
  int sortorder; // 0 = ascending, 1 = descending (only used by Lucene)
  text_t fuzziness; // Search fuzziness amount between 0.0 and 1.0 (only used by Lucene)
  int startresults;
  int endresults;

  queryparamclass ();
  void clear ();
  queryparamclass &operator=(const queryparamclass &q);
};
